How Much Does Professional Lawn Care Cost?

The cost of professional lawn care services can vary depending on several factors, such as the size of your lawn, the condition of the grass, and the specific services you require.

On average, you can expect to pay anywhere from $30-$80 per hour for basic lawn care services like mowing, trimming, and edging. The cost may increase if you require additional services like fertilization, weed control, or pest control.

It’s always a good idea to get quotes from several lawn care providers in your area to compare prices and services. Remember that the cheapest option may not always be the best, as the quality of service and reliability are also important factors to consider when selecting a lawn care professional.

What Are The Potential Risks Of DIY Lawn Care?

While DIY lawn care can save you money and give you a sense of satisfaction, it does come with some potential risks. Here are a few to keep in mind:

  • Accidental damage to your lawn – If you don’t have experience in lawn care, it’s possible to accidentally kill your grass or plants through over-fertilization or incorrect application of pesticides or herbicides.
  • Harmful environmental impact – Improper use of chemicals and fertilizers can have negative environmental impacts, harming wildlife and polluting water sources.
  • Personal injury – Lawn care often involves using tools and equipment that can be dangerous if not used correctly. Lawnmowers, trimmers, and other tools can cause severe injury to yourself or others if mishandled.
  • Time-based commitment – Lawn care can be time-consuming, and if you’re doing it yourself, it can be easy to underestimate the time required to maintain a healthy lawn.

How Can I Maintain A Healthy Lawn Without Professional Help?

Maintaining a healthy lawn can be accomplished without professional help by following a few simple steps:

  • Water your lawn properly: It is crucial for maintaining its health. It’s important to water your lawn deeply and infrequently rather than shallowly and often, which encourages shallow root growth.
  • Mow your lawn correctly: It is essential for keeping it healthy. Ideally, you should mow when the grass is dry and only remove 1/3 of the blades’ length each time. Also, leave the clippings on the lawn as a natural fertilizer.
  • Fertilize your lawn: It is important to maintain its health. Many options for organic fertilizers are available online or at your local store.
  • Control weeds: Weeds compete with grass for nutrients and water, so removing them will help maintain the lawn’s health. Options include removing them by hand or using natural herbicides like vinegar or corn gluten meal.

What Are The Most Common Lawn Care Treatments?

When people think of lawn care services, they often think of mowing the lawn and trimming the edges. While these are certainly important components of lawn maintenance, many other treatments should also be considered when evaluating the value of a lawn care service.

Common lawn care treatments include aeration, overseeding, fertilization, weed control, and pest control.

  • Aeration helps to loosen compacted soil, allowing air, water, and nutrients to pass through more easily.
  • Overseeding replenishes grass or fills in bare patches.
  • Fertilization helps ensure the lawn receives the nutrients it needs to remain healthy.
  • Weed control is necessary to prevent the growth of unwanted weeds.
  • Pest control helps to keep insects, such as grubs, from damaging the lawn.

Each of these treatments is essential to maintaining a healthy lawn and should be considered when evaluating the value of a lawn care service.

What is the best way to maintain a healthy lawn?

The best way to maintain a healthy lawn is to fertilize it regularly, mow it regularly (at the recommended height for the grass type), water it deeply and infrequently, and promptly remove any weeds or pests. Additionally, aerating the lawn and topdressing with compost can help improve soil quality and promote healthy grass growth.
